Campomorone, Liguria, Italy

Overview

Campomorone is a tranquil Ligurian town located just north of Genoa, featuring scenic hillsides, traditional architecture, and a welcoming local community. It's an ideal base for outdoor excursions, with easy access to regional parks and authentic Italian eateries.

Best Time to Visit

April-June for mild spring weather and September-October for pleasant autumn temperatures.

Local Tips

Parking is generally free or inexpensive outside the center; bring comfortable shoes for hilly terrain. Public transport connects easily with Genoa.

Cultural Etiquette

Tipping is not obligatory but appreciated; dress modestly in religious venues. Greeting locals with a friendly 'Buongiorno' goes a long way.

Safety Warnings

Campomorone is very safe; however, use caution on rural trails after dusk. Occasional pickpocketing may occur during town events, keep valuables secure.
